Report Overview
By 2030, the market for fuselage frame models is projected to have grown from USD 433.8 million in 2022 to USD 735.1 million, with a CAGR of 6.8% during the forecast period of 2023–2030.
Russia has had a considerable impact on the global market for fuselage frame modelling through its aerospace sector and manufacturer participation in aircraft design and development.
For example, Irkut Corporation, a UAC subsidiary, developed the medium-range airliner MC-21. The MC-21 uses cutting-edge composite materials and unique design ideas, such as enhanced fuselage structure modelling, to minimise weight and increase fuel efficiency. The application of advanced modelling methodologies increases the MC-21's performance and competitiveness on the global market. As a result, Russia accounts for one-fifth of the regional market share.

Market Dynamics
Demand for Lightweight and Fuel-Efficient Aircraft is Growing
The aviation industry's emphasis on fuel economy and environmental sustainability is driving demand for lightweight aircraft designs. Fuselage frame modelling is critical for structural design optimisation, weight reduction, and fuel efficiency enhancement in order to fulfil the aviation industry's goals for more affordable and environmentally friendly aircraft.
For example, the fuselage of the Boeing 787 Dreamliner makes extensive use of composite materials, enhancing fuel efficiency by 20% over previous-generation aircraft. Airlines favoured the Dreamliner due to its fuel efficiency advantage, which has increased demand for lightweight composite fuselage technology.
Increased Aircraft Manufacturing and Fleet Expansion
Because of the increased manufacturing of aircraft, manufacturers and aerospace industries require modelling services to build and analyse fuselage frames. The market for fuselage frame modelling is growing as a result of increased demand for modelling services. Modelling expertise, software, and analysis tools are in high demand as aircraft production rates increase.
The Airbus A320neo family is an excellent example of how growing fleet size and aircraft production drive up need for fuselage frame modelling. The A320neo series, which comprises the A319neo, A320neo, and A321neo, has received significant orders and deliveries around the world.

Fuselage Frame Modelling Market Companies
The major global players include Airbus, Boeing, Bombardier Aerospace, Embraer, Leonardo S.p.A. (formerly Finmeccanica), Lockheed Martin Corporation, Safran, Northrop Grumman Corporation, Mitsubishi Heavy Industries and COMAC (Commercial Aircraft Corporation of China).
